Promoting Tourist Influx and Revitalizing the Local Economy
Gurye-gun, Jeollanam-do announced on the 14th that it has been finally selected for the Jeollanam-do-led 「Namdo Landscape Creation Project」 contest.
The Namdo Landscape Creation Project is a contest promoted by Jeollanam-do to discover representative landscape models of Namdo by utilizing differentiated and attractive landscape resources, aiming to attract tourists and revitalize the local economy.
This contest was conducted targeting 22 cities and counties in Jeollanam-do, and the final target sites were selected through the first document screening and the second on-site evaluation. Gurye-gun, which was finally selected in this contest, secured a project budget of 1 billion KRW (300 million KRW from the provincial government).
Gurye-gun plans to create a nighttime landscape attraction by installing nighttime landscape lighting (sculptural landscape lighting, light tunnel landscape lighting, tree lights, etc.), convenience facilities, and photo zones along the embankment area of Seosicheon Stream in Gurye-eup, where flood recovery was completed, incorporating storytelling that heals the pain of the flood on August 8, 2020.
Kim Soon-ho, the county governor, said, “I hope this Namdo Landscape Creation Project will provide a new healing space for all Gurye residents who overcame difficult times together and greatly help attract nighttime tourists and revitalize the local economy.”
